Milan Stitt (1941-2009) was an influential American playwright and educator known for his notable works in theater and television. Born in Detroit, he earned degrees from the University of Michigan and Yale School of Drama. His most acclaimed play, 'The Runner Stumbles,' garnered significant recognition, including being named Best Broadway Play of 1976. Stitt was a prominent figure at Circle Repertory Company, teaching drama at various prestigious universities. He worked as a dramaturg, produced numerous plays, and contributed to television, including Emmy-nominated projects. He mentored emerging playwrights and actively participated in theater communities.
